Contact us

Please note that we are not in a position to receive spontaneous visits.

Kindly send your inquires by a detailed email to [email protected]
or call us during our phone hours: Monday-Friday, 10:00-12:00 and 14:00-16:00, telephone +46 101012800

Please include the following information:

  • First name
  • Last name
  • Date of birth
  • Where you currently live
  • Country of origin
  • Phone number
  • Who your request concerns
  • What your concern is
